Title : Structured Error Data for Filtered DNS
Authors : Dan Wing
Tirumaleswar Reddy
Neil Cook
Mohamed Boucadair
Filename : draft-ietf-dnsop-structured-dns-error-03.txt
Pages : 21
Date : 2023-05-26
Abstract:
DNS filtering is widely deployed for various reasons, including
network security. However, filtered DNS responses lack information
for end users to understand the reason for the filtering. Existing
mechanisms to provide explanatory details to end users cause harm
especially if the blocked DNS response is to an HTTPS server.
This document updates RFC 8914 by signaling client support for
structuring the EXTRA-TEXT field of the Extended DNS Error to provide
details on the DNS filtering. Such details can be parsed by the
client and displayed, logged, or used for other purposes.
